Responsible for the architectural design and development of the company's data center.
Continuously deliver data value to the company's businesses with high quality, low cost and high efficiency
Provide solutions for platform architecture and performance optimization, and lead the rapid iteration of big data platform.
Enabling the rapid development of the company's business through data-driven, and continuously improving the company's core competitiveness.
Job Requirements
Bachelor degree or above in computer science or related majors, more than 3 years of experience in Java development, proficient in Java development, in-depth understanding of jvm principle.
Familiar with commonly used frameworks (Spring, Spring MVC, gRPC, Mybatis) and be able to master its principles and mechanisms
Solid computer fundamentals, master computer operating systems, network architecture, familiar with commonly used algorithms, data structures and commonly used design patterns.
Familiar with distributed, caching, messaging and other mechanisms, redis, kafka, spark, flink, zookeeper, tidb experience is preferred.
Experience in data center or microservice design and development, with a focus on and understanding of high availability and scalability of architecture is preferred.
Experience in tagging system or algorithmic recommendation system is preferred.
Full of enthusiasm and expectation for the blockchain industry, committed to work hard for the development of the industry